anOrdain Model 1 (Group Buy)

Owners widely praise the anOrdain Model 1 (Group Buy) for its exceptional vitreous enamel dials, custom typography, and elegant design, noting the dials' unique craftsmanship and light-reflecting qualities. The updated G100 movement is appreciated for its extended power reserve, and the case finishing is described as well-executed with a high-polish finish. Some reviewers suggest the case could be slightly slimmer. The significant wait time, ranging from nearly two years to over two and a half years, is a notable drawback frequently mentioned by owners. Overall, owners and reviewers rate the anOrdain Model 1 (Group Buy) highly for its unique enamel dials and appealing design at its price point.

Seiko Prospex Sea 1965 Heritage Diver's Watch PADI Special Edition

The Seiko Prospex Sea 1965 Heritage Diver's Watch PADI Special Edition is praised for its attractive emerald green sunburst dial with gold accents and its comfortable wearability. Owners note the dial looks gorgeous in the right light, and some find it fits better than other models. The watch features a 40mm steel case, a domed sapphire crystal, and 300m water resistance, powered by the 6R55 movement with a 72-hour power reserve. However, some find the watch wears top-heavy due to its density and case design, and the bracelet clasp is criticized for stamped parts and limited micro-adjustment. The retail price of €1,700 is considered high by some, with sales recommended. Overall, owners and reviewers appreciate the dial's beauty and the watch's comfortable fit, despite some reservations about its weight distribution and bracelet clasp.
